    Just got my very first pair, i known my eye sight was starting to fail me for the last few years.
    Had to move a book or a paper further and further away but in the end my arms were just not long enough, so had my eyes tested and it turns out i have far-sightedness. These glasses are killing me though i can feel my eyes straining when ever i put them on and i get such a headache, is this normal??
